The Honeymooners Season 9 Episode 171

Episode Title: Six Months to Live
Genre: Comedy, Family
Countries: USA,
Airing Date: November 23, 1968
Runtime:30 mins
IMDb Rating:

The Honeymooners: When Ralph is always tired, he goes to the doctor. Alice brings her mother's dog to the vet, but doesn't want Ralph to know because it cost him $9. The vet sends over a letter about the dog's impending doom, and Ralph thinks the note is meant for him. Not having anything to bequeath to Alice, he and Norton decide to sell Ralph's story to a magazine. They decide to do a full feature on him, and he then figures out that he's not dying. He and Norton concoct a scheme of Norton being the only doctor in the world that can cure Ralph, but they get caught. Luckily, the magazine editor likes the real story better and doesn't press charges. All is well and it's, "Baby, you're the greatest!" Running time: This is a remake of "Six Months To Live" (10/4/1952) & "A Matter of Life and Death" (10/29/1955). This episode does not appear on the "American Life TV Network".
